Dispute risks future of crane company

AN escalation of an industrial dispute could threaten the future of the Liebherr crane company in Kerry.

SIPTU members late last week refused to cooperate with non-union drivers making deliveries, or collecting consignments, from the factory in Killarney, the company claimed.

“This reckless action has immediate, critical implications for the continuing operation of our manufacturing facilities,” Liebherr personnel manager Tom Foley warned in a circular to staff.
